    * There's been an update a while ago bringing TouchOSC to version 1.4.2 and the Editor to 1.1.1. A couple of problems have been corrected, like some characters in Label's texts corrupting layouts, a global switch to turn off the previously added "z" messages (seemed to cause problems with certain software) and proper handling of strings sent to TouchOSC as UTF8. Be sure to grab the updated Editor as well if you download the update from iTunes.

    * I've been working on an Android port of TouchOSC, which turned out to be much easier than I expected. But wait, TouchOSC will not show up on the Android Market anytime soon... One of the things that sadly does make it more complicated to program for Android is the existence of many different devices running the platform and there will have to be extensive testing on as many as possible, so if you are interested in helping doing just that drop me an email at dev AT hexler DOT net and let me know which phone you use and which version Android you are running.
